Skip to content

Not working on flatpaks when Extension installed via AUR #398

@Vishwamz

Description

@Vishwamz

Describe the bug
Is not working on flatpaks with Extension installed via AUR

To Reproduce
Steps to reproduce the behavior:

  1. Installed extension using ' yay -S gnome-shell-extension-unite '
  2. logged out logged in
  3. Done changes required to hide Title bars (work on system apps)
  4. Done both flatpak --override and forcing files using flatseal. Used /usr/share/gnome-shell/extensions/unite@hardpixel.eu as path for my extensions files as extension is install in system.
  5. Can still see the Title bar (not hidden)

Expected behavior
Hidden Title bar in flatpak apps

Screenshots

Image

Environment (please complete the following information):

  • OS: [e.g. EndeavourOS ]
  • GNOME Shell version [e.g. 48]
  • Unite version [e.g. 82]

Logs
Provide system logs related to unite extension using journalctl -g unite.

Apr 18 08:52:44 EndeavourOS sudo[8765]: vishwam : TTY=pts/0 ; PWD=/home/vishwam ; USER=root ; COMMAND=/usr/bin/pacman -U --config /etc/pac>
Apr 18 08:52:45 EndeavourOS sudo[8776]: vishwam : TTY=pts/0 ; PWD=/home/vishwam ; USER=root ; COMMAND=/usr/bin/pacman -D --asexplicit -q ->
Apr 18 08:59:44 EndeavourOS gnome-shell[10121]: Extension unite@hardpixel.eu already installed in /usr/share/gnome-shell/extensions/unite@h>
Apr 18 09:02:13 EndeavourOS ulauncher.desktop[12243]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with san>
Apr 18 09:02:13 EndeavourOS extension-manag[12255]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gn>
Apr 18 09:02:38 EndeavourOS ulauncher.desktop[12303]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with san>
Apr 18 09:02:38 EndeavourOS ulauncher.desktop[12314]: [2, Main Thread] WARNING: Theme parsing error: gtk.css:2:105: Failed to import: Error>
Apr 18 09:02:38 EndeavourOS zen[12314]: Theme parsing error: gtk.css:2:105: Failed to import: Error opening file /usr/share/gnome-shell/ext>
Apr 18 09:04:03 EndeavourOS gnome-shell[12936]: Extension unite@hardpixel.eu already installed in /usr/share/gnome-shell/extensions/unite@h>
Apr 18 09:04:14 EndeavourOS ulauncher.desktop[14263]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with san>
Apr 18 09:04:15 EndeavourOS extension-manag[14291]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gn>
Apr 18 09:04:25 EndeavourOS ulauncher.desktop[14395]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with san>
Apr 18 09:04:25 EndeavourOS extension-manag[14407]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gn>
Apr 18 09:04:44 EndeavourOS ulauncher.desktop[14463]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with san>
Apr 18 09:04:44 EndeavourOS com.github.tchx[14474]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gn>
-- Boot 07e429a2280d4d489babc1609ac5b08e --
Apr 18 09:05:25 EndeavourOS gnome-shell[838]: Extension unite@hardpixel.eu already installed in /usr/share/gnome-shell/extensions/unite@har>
Apr 18 09:05:36 EndeavourOS ulauncher.desktop[2111]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with sand>
Apr 18 09:05:36 EndeavourOS extension-manag[2283]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:09:12 EndeavourOS ulauncher.desktop[3251]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with sand>
Apr 18 09:09:13 EndeavourOS com.github.tchx[3262]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:23:22 EndeavourOS ulauncher.desktop[4116]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with sand>
Apr 18 09:23:22 EndeavourOS extension-manag[4128]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:28:04 EndeavourOS ulauncher.desktop[4900]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u/styles" with sand>
Apr 18 09:28:05 EndeavourOS com.github.tchx[4911]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:31:09 EndeavourOS ulauncher.desktop[5083]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u" with sandbox: Pa>
Apr 18 09:31:09 EndeavourOS extension-manag[5095]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:32:57 EndeavourOS sudo[5265]: vishwam : TTY=pts/0 ; PWD=/home/vishwam ; USER=root ; COMMAND=/usr/bin/flatpak override --filesyst>
Apr 18 09:32:57 EndeavourOS polkitd[655]: Registered Authentication Agent for unix-process:5270:166343 (system bus name :1.156 [flatpak ove>
Apr 18 09:33:15 EndeavourOS ulauncher.desktop[5318]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u" with sandbox: Pa>
Apr 18 09:33:16 EndeavourOS extension-manag[5330]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
-- Boot 51a5a537abb945e79327b70c5483782e --
Apr 18 09:34:40 EndeavourOS gnome-shell[820]: Extension unite@hardpixel.eu already installed in /usr/share/gnome-shell/extensions/unite@har>
Apr 18 09:34:48 EndeavourOS ulauncher.desktop[2081]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u" with sandbox: Pa>
Apr 18 09:34:49 EndeavourOS extension-manag[2100]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:34:56 EndeavourOS ulauncher.desktop[2373]: F: Not sharing "/usr/share/gnome-shell/extensions/unite@hardpixel.eu" with sandbox: Pa>
Apr 18 09:34:56 EndeavourOS extension-manag[2385]: Theme parser error: gtk.css:2:1-106: Failed to import: Error opening file /usr/share/gno>
Apr 18 09:36:54 EndeavourOS sudo[3168]: vishwam : TTY=pts/1 ; PWD=/home/vishwam ; USER=root ; COMMAND=/usr/bin/pacman -R -s --config /etc/>
Apr 18 09:37:14 EndeavourOS gsd-color[3982]: Theme parsing error: gtk.css:2:105: Failed to import: Error opening file /usr/share/gnome-shel>
Apr 18 09:37:14 EndeavourOS gsd-power[3998]: Theme parsing error: gtk.css:2:105: Failed to import: Error opening file /usr/share/gnome-shel>
lines 1-46

Additional context
Works completely fine when Installed extension using wget and giving path as xdg-data

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ions